If you hear the word "Hang", you may think it is a Chinese word. It could be, for example, a Chinese dynasty, as were the Ming or Han dynastys. If you see the musical instrument "Hang", you may think that it is an ancient instrument from some Asian country. But it's not.

The "Hang" is a musical instrument created by two Swiss, Felix Rohner and Sabina Schärer in 1999. It is formed by two metal structures, shaped like a plate, joined by the edge. The inside of the instrument is empty, while on the outside it has ornaments and circular indentations of different sizes, created by hammering the structure in the shape of a flying saucer.

The Hang is sounded by blows with the hands; blows of different intensities in the different parts of the instrument, thus creating a large variety of sounds depending on the size of the indentations, ornaments, pieces, etc... The sound can be muffled or louder, depending on how long the hand remains in contact with the instrument after striking it. The fact that hands are used is what gave rise to its name, as "Hang" means "hand" in the Swiss-German dialect spoken in Bern (Switzerland).

Wrocław’s dwarfs (Polish: krasnale, krasnoludki) are small figurines (20-30 cm) that first appeared in the streets of Wrocław, Poland, in 2005. Since then, their numbers have been continually growing, and today they are considered a tourist attraction: those who would like to combine sight-seeing in Wrocław with "Hunting for dwarfs" are offered special brochures with a map[1] and mobile application software for smartphones.[2] As of 2015, there are over 350 dwarfs spread all over the city. Six of them are located outside the city at the LG plant in Biskupice Podgórne.

Wrocław’s dwarfs are small figurines (20-30 cm) that first appeared in the streets of Wrocław, Poland, in 2005. Since then, their numbers have been continually growing, and today they are considered a tourist attraction: those who would like to combine light-seeing in Wrocław with "Hunting for dwarfs" are offered special brochures with a map and mobile application software for smartphones. As of 2015, there are over 350 dwarfs spread all over the city. In 2001, to commemorate the Orange Alternative (Polish anti-communist movement), a monument of a dwarf (the movement’s symbol) was officially placed on Świdnicka Street, where the group’s happenings used to take place. The figures of the dwarfs, which are smaller than the Orange Alternative monument on Świdnicka Street, were placed in different parts of the city. The first five, designed by Tomasz Moczek, a graduate of The Academy of Art and Design in Wrocław, were placed in August 2005. Since that time, the number of figures has continued growing.

An auto rickshaw or three-wheeler (tuk-tuk, trishaw, auto, rickshaw, autorick, bajaj, rick, tricycle, mototaxi, baby taxi or lapa in popular parlance) is a usually three-wheeled cabin cycle for private use and as a vehicle for hire. It is a motorized version of the traditional pulled rickshaw or cycle rickshaw. Auto rickshaws are an essential form of urban transport in many developing countries, and a form of novelty transport in many Eastern countries.

 

Auto rickshaws (often called just auto) are common all over India, and provide cheap and efficient transportation. New auto rickshaws run on CNG and are environmentally friendly. Typical mileage for an Indian-made auto rickshaw is around 35 kilometers per liter of petrol (about 2.9 L per 100 km, or 82 miles per gallon [United States (wet measure), 100 miles per gallon Imperial (United Kingdom, Canada)].

 

Painted Auto rickshaw in Sajanagarh, Baleswar, OrissaMany major nationalized banks in India offer loans to self-employed individuals seeking to buy auto rickshaws. Auto rickshaw manufacturers in India include Bajaj Auto, Kumar Motors, Kerala Auto Limited, Force Motors (previously Bajaj Tempo), Mahindra & Mahindra, Piaggio Ape and TVS Motors. Auto rickshaws are found in cities, villages and in the countryside.

 

A very old auto rickshaw in Bhedaghat, Madhya Pradesh.Such autos are the only means of public transport in some parts of rural IndiaThere are two types of autorickshaws in India. In older versions the engines were situated below driver's seat. In newer versions engines are in rear portion. They normally run on petrol, CNG and diesel. The seating capacity of a normal rickshaw is 4, including driver. There are also six-seater rickshaws in parts of Maharashtra. In cities and towns across India it is the backbone of city transport. Normally their fare rates are controlled by govt. They have traffic meters.

 

In July 1998, the Supreme Court of India ordered the Delhi government to implement CNG or LPG (Autogas) fuel for all autos and for the entire bus fleet in and around the city. Delhi's air quality has improved with the switch to CNG. Initially, auto rickshaw drivers in Delhi had to wait in long queues for CNG refueling, but the situation has improved with the increase of CNG stations. CNG autos were distinguishable from the erstwhile petrol-powered autos by having a green and yellow livery as opposed to the earlier black and yellow. Certain local governments are pushing for four-stroke engines instead of the current two-stroke versions.

 

On february 11 2012, a website was launched based on public interest to reveal the auto fares for the southern cities like Chennai, Hyderabad, Bangalore. The beta version website is www.meterpodu.in. Here in the website even migrants can update the fares keeping their recent experience of travel between the specific areas, provided they should have an authenticated account in either facebook or twitter. The service of this site has extended for the cities like Mysore and Coimbatore. In this connection the service is yet to arrive as a mobile application in android phones.

Our 2015 Top 10 list

 

1. On-Demand Ambient Computing.

On-Demand Ambient Computing driven by AI will usher in a world of invisible computing that will drive efficiencies across many industries. Growth will come from API's/algorithms across mobile platforms; AI will predict human intent and deliver items/information at the speed of human thought. [Shervin Pishevar]

 

2. Traditional Banks Will Continue Losing Share to Startups while Bitcoin Fades in Relevance.

Financial-services institutions will continue to be disintermediated, and will either act as the back-end infrastructure or co-exist as they do in the Lending Club model. Meanwhile, Bitcoin as a currency and remittance solution will lose steam. [Rebecca Lynn]

 

3. The Virtual Me.

Advances in hardware and sensors and the adoption of connected devices will create an explosion of personal data in the next 5 years. With increased data processing capabilities and smarter predictive software, all this data will be aggregated into personal digital profiles – the virtual you – which will know even more about you than you do. [Jenny Lee]

 

4. The Skynet Economy: broadband access for the unconnected billions.

From thousands of satellites orbiting around the poles, and new airborne transponders, the entire Earth will be bathed in broadband, bringing an unprecedented influx of human talent to the global economy. [Steve Jurvetson]

 

5. The End of the Auto Nation.

For the better part of a century, the United States has designed its cities around the notion of individual car ownership. This has resulted in massive waste, congestion, pollution, long commute times, remarkably underutilized capital assets, and over 30,000 deaths per year. Suburban sprawl reached its ultimate limit, and the trends are all rebounding around a new urbanization. [Bill Gurley]

 

6. 5th Mode of Transportation.

5th Mode of Transportation will be unlocked in the next 5 years. Technologies like Hyperloop will skip over 19th and 20th century transportation modes and do what wireless mobile communication did to fixed line telecommunications in places like Africa. [Shervin Pishevar]

 

7. Reemergence of Women in Tech.

In the next 5 years, 50% of computer-science students will be women – surpassing the previous high set in 1984. This means you’ll increasingly see more female technology startup founders and Fortune-500 CEOs. [Rebecca Lynn]

 

8. The Economy of Me.

By 2020, mobile will bring the next 2 billion people online and make the online economy more powerful than the offline. This shift will breed decentralized business models. Commerce and services will skip the middle man and revolve around the individual consumer. Welcome to the personal economy. [Jenny Lee]

 

9. Rise of the Robocars: Driven by a Machine [the winning trend].

By 2020 we will no longer debate the inevitability of autonomous electric vehicles when we first experience the convenience and efficiency of urban autonomous driving services. [Steve Jurvetson]

 

10. The Native Mobile Application Platform Dominates the “Mobile Web”.

Consumers drastically prefer mobile applications to the mobile web because they are WAY better. The majority of incremental Internet users will be exclusively on smartphones. The aging search/browser platform will be stifled as a fertile ground for new innovation. [Bill Gurley]

The Ebola-Info-Sharing mobile application was launched by the ITU on 19 December 2014. The free to download application is to be used in the campaign against the Ebola disease outbreak. The App is intended to facilitate coordination among organizations responding to the Ebola crisis and offers the general public access to the latest Ebola news from official sources, including an interactive map on Ebola.

 

This mobile App has been developed based on inputs from organizations involved in the Fight Against the Ebola Crisis who are working directly on the ground, in the Ebola-affected countries. The App focuses on sharing precise information, locations and focal points related to Ebola with the public and organizations.

 

Official news and key points on the map are available to the public.

 

Organizations have specific features for sharing useful information with staff on the ground and other organizations, including contact and information repositories. These features are dedicated to organizations and protected by login/password combination.

 

Available for Android devices via the Google Play Store and will soon be available for iOS devices via the Apple App Store.

Santa Maria de Ovila is a former Cistercian monastery built in Spain beginning in 1181 on the Tagus River near Trillo, Guadalajara, about 90 miles (140 km) northeast of Madrid. During prosperous times over the next four centuries, construction projects expanded and improved the small monastery. Its fortunes declined significantly in the 1700s, and in 1835 it was confiscated by the Spanish government and sold to private owners who used its buildings to shelter farm animals. American publisher William Randolph Hearst bought parts of the monastery in 1931 with the intention of using its stones in the construction of a grand and fanciful castle at Wyntoon, California, but after some 10,000 stones were removed and shipped, they were abandoned in San Francisco for decades. These stones are now in various locations around California: the old church portal has been reassembled at the University of San Francisco, and the chapter house is being reassembled by Trappist monks at the Abbey of New Clairvaux in Vina, California. In Spain, the new government of the Second Republic declared the monastery a National Monument in June 1931, but not in time to prevent the mass removal of stones. Today, the remnant buildings and walls stand on private farmland. (more...)

 

RKO Pictures is an American film production and distribution company. It was one of the Big Five studios of Hollywood's Golden Age. The business was formed after the Keith-Albee-Orpheum (KAO) theater chains and Joseph P. Kennedy's Film Booking Offices of America (FBO) studio were brought together under the control of the Radio Corporation of America (RCA) in October 1928. RKO has long been celebrated for its cycle of musicals starring Fred Astaire and Ginger Rogers in the mid- to late 1930s. Actors Katharine Hepburn and, later, Robert Mitchum had their first major successes at the studio. Cary Grant was a mainstay for years. The work of producer Val Lewton's low-budget horror unit and RKO's many ventures into the field now known as film noir have been acclaimed by film critics and historians. The studio produced two of the most famous films in motion picture history: King Kong (poster pictured) and Citizen Kane. Maverick industrialist Howard Hughes took over RKO in 1948. After years of decline under his control, the studio was acquired by the General Tire and Rubber Company in 1955. The original RKO Pictures ceased production in 1957 and was effectively dissolved two years later. (more...)

Jay Farrar was a founding member of Uncle Tupelo and his decision to leave the band resulted in the band's breakup.

 

Uncle Tupelo was an alternative country music group from Belleville, Illinois, active between 1987 and 1994. Jay Farrar (pictured), Jeff Tweedy, and Mike Heidorn formed the band after the lead singer of their previous band, The Primitives, left to attend college. The trio recorded three albums for Rockville Records, before signing with Sire Records and expanding to a five-piece. Shortly after the release of the band's major label debut album Anodyne, Farrar announced his decision to leave the band due to a soured relationship with his co-songwriter Tweedy. Uncle Tupelo split on May 1, 1994, after completing a farewell tour. Following the breakup, Farrar formed Son Volt with Heidorn, while the remaining members continued as Wilco. Although Uncle Tupelo broke up before they achieved commercial success, the band is renowned for its impact on the alternative country music scene. The group's first album, No Depression, became a byword for the genre and was widely influential. Uncle Tupelo's sound was unlike popular country music of the time, drawing inspiration from styles as diverse as the hardcore punk of The Minutemen and the country instrumentation and harmony of the Carter Family and Hank Williams. Farrar and Tweedy lyrics frequently referred to Middle America and the working class of Belleville. (more...)

Courageous photographed during World War I

 

The Courageous class comprised three battlecruisers built for the Royal Navy during World War I. Nominally designed to support Admiral of the Fleet Lord John Fisher's Baltic Project, which was intended to land troops on the German Baltic Coast, ships of this class were fast but very lightly armoured with only a few heavy guns. To maximize their speed, the Courageous-class battlecruisers were the first capital ships of the Royal Navy to use geared steam turbines and small-tube boilers. The first two ships, Courageous and Glorious, were commissioned in 1917 and spent the war patrolling the North Sea. Their half-sister Furious was designed with a pair of 18-inch (457 mm) guns, the largest guns ever fitted on a ship of the Royal Navy, but was modified during construction to take a flying-off deck and hangar in lieu of her forward gun turret and barbette. All three ships were laid up after the end of the war and were rebuilt as aircraft carriers during the 1920s. (more...)

Sunset on Ganoga Lake

 

Ganoga Lake is a natural lake in Colley Township in southeast Sullivan County in Pennsylvania, United States. The Ricketts family purchased the lake in the early 1850s, and built a stone house on the lake shore by 1852 or 1855; this served as a hunting lodge and tavern. R. Bruce Ricketts added the lake to his extensive holdings after the American Civil War, and in 1873 built a large wooden addition north of the stone house, which became the North Mountain House hotel. The hotel had one of the first summer schools in the United States in 1876 and 1877. After the death of R. Bruce Ricketts in 1918, his heirs sold much of his 80,000 acres (32,000 ha) to the state for Pennsylvania State Game Lands and Ricketts Glen State Park. The state tried to purchase the lake in 1957, but was outbid by investors who turned the land around it into a private housing development; as such it is "off limits" to the public. Ganoga Lake is on the Allegheny Plateau, just north of the Allegheny Front, in sedimentary rocks from the Pocono Formation. The Wisconsin Glaciation some 20,000 years ago changed the drainage patterns of the lake; this diverted its waters to Kitchen Creek and carved the 24 named waterfalls in Ricketts Glen State Park in the process. (more...)

The Stolt Kittiwake heading toward the Mersey Estuary, 2005

 

The Manchester Ship Canal is a river navigation 36 miles (58 km) long in the North West of England. Starting at the Mersey Estuary near Liverpool, it generally follows the original routes of the rivers Mersey and Irwell through the historic counties of Cheshire and Lancashire. Major landmarks along its route include the Barton Swing Aqueduct and Trafford Park. By the late 19th century the Mersey and Irwell Navigation had fallen into disrepair and was often unusable, and Manchester's business community viewed Liverpool's dock and the railway companies' charges as excessive. A ship canal was proposed as a way of giving ocean-going vessels direct access to Manchester. Construction began in 1887; it took six years and cost about £15 million. When the ship canal opened in January 1894 it was the largest river navigation canal in the world. Although it enabled the newly created Port of Manchester to become Britain's third busiest portdespite the city being about 40 miles (64 km) inlandthe canal never achieved the commercial success its sponsors had hoped for. Ships often returned to sea loaded with ballast rather than goods for export, and gradually the balance of traffic moved to the west, resulting in the closure of the terminal docks at Salford. As of 2011, traffic had decreased from its peak in 1958 of 18 million long tons (20 million short tons) of freight each year to about 7 million long tons (7.8 million short tons). The canal is now privately owned by Peel Ports. (more...)

Illustration from William J. Long's School of the Woods (1902), showing an otter teaching her young to swim

 

The nature fakers controversy was an early 20th-century American literary debate highlighting the conflict between science and sentiment in popular nature writing. Following a period of growing interest in the natural world beginning in the late 19th century, a new literary movement, in which the natural world was depicted in a compassionate rather than realistic light, began to take shape. Works such as Ernest Thompson Seton's Wild Animals I Have Known (1898) and William J. Long's School of the Woods (1902) popularized this new genre and emphasized sympathetic and individualistic animal characters. In March 1903, naturalist and writer John Burroughs published an article entitled "Real and Sham Natural History" in the Atlantic Monthly. Lambasting writers for their seemingly fantastical representations of wildlife, he also denounced the booming genre of realistic animal fiction as "yellow journalism of the woods". Burroughs' targets responded in defense of their work in various publications, as did their supporters, and the resulting controversy raged in the public press for nearly six years. Dubbed the "War of the Naturalists", the controversy effectively ended when President Theodore Roosevelt publicly sided with Burroughs, publishing his article "Nature Fakers" in the September 1907 issue of Everybody's Magazine. Roosevelt popularized the negative colloquialism by which the controversy would later be known to describe one who purposefully fabricates details about the natural world. (more...)

AT&T Launches Major Initiative to Bring 'Apps to All'

 

Company Also Plans to Launch Five Android-Based Devices in First Half of 2010

 

Las Vegas, Nevada, January 6, 2010

newsrelease

 

AT&T today announced plans to launch five new devices from Dell, HTC and Motorola based on the Android platform. The company also announced a major initiative to expand the universe of mobile applications beyond smartphones to more mobile phones – and spur future app development for emerging consumer electronics devices, its U-verse TV platform, and enterprise and small business workplaces.

 

At the 4th annual AT&T Developer Summit in Las Vegas, executives outlined details including:

 

* New devices that will give customers the most robust choices of major operating systems (OS), including Android™, in the U.S.

* A goal to offer all major smartphone OS app stores

* An agreement with Qualcomm to standardize apps development for mid-range Quick Messaging Devices using BREW Mobile Platform. These devices are used by millions of customers who historically have not had the same convenient access as smartphone customers to the market’s hottest apps

* A new AT&T SDK (software developer kit) to help developers immediately begin to develop apps for these devices

* A significantly enhanced developer program and new relationships with global carriers that are intended to make it easier for developers to distribute apps in markets outside the U.S.

* Future initiatives to enable developers to create more apps for AT&T’s U-verse TV, emerging consumer electronics devices, and businesses

* A new AT&T Virtual Innovation Lab and two new Innovation Centers, which will help developers and spur apps development

 

“Applications help consumers realize the full value and benefits of mobile broadband networks, services and devices,” said Ralph de la Vega, president and CEO, AT&T Mobility and Consumer Markets. “Today some AT&T customers can take advantage of more than 100,000 apps – but only if they have the right handset. Our goal is to bring more apps to millions more of our customers who want convenient access to the market’s hottest apps. At the same time, in the future, we plan to go well beyond mobile devices to spur apps development.”

 

In addition to ultimately giving more customers more choices of applications, the long-term strategic initiatives announced today will make it easier for developers to cost effectively create applications and reach broader audiences, and help AT&T drive data revenues.

 

Extend Smartphone Leadership

AT&T will further its leadership in smartphones with the planned launch of five new devices from Dell, HTC and Motorola based on the Android platform. Those devices, which are scheduled to be available during the first half of 2010, include:

 

* A Motorola smartphone, powered by MOTOBLUR, with a unique form factor and an AT&T exclusive

* Dell’s first smartphone, based on the Android platform and an AT&T exclusive

* A HTC smartphone, based on the Android platform, and an AT&T exclusive

 

AT&T customers with these devices will benefit not only from the nation’s fastest 3G network but also the ability to simultaneously talk on the phone while surfing the Web or reading email. Customers can sign up for email notifications as more details are available at www.att.com/android.

 

In addition, AT&T announced its goal to lead the industry in application choices for smartphone customers by offering all major app stores. It will preload the corresponding store for each device -- giving customers convenient access to thousands of apps optimized for their smartphone. Today, AT&T added to existing agreements with Nokia for Ovi store and Microsoft for Windows Marketplace by announcing an agreement for Android Market. It expects to announce more app store agreements in the near future and will offer carrier billing as an easy and convenient payment option for as many stores as possible.

 

‘Apps for All’ by Standardizing Apps Development with Brew Mobile Platform

De la Vega also announced a significant new agreement with Qualcomm to standardize apps development by adopting BREW Mobile Platform. With this agreement, AT&T intends to make BREW Mobile Platform its primary operating system platform for Quick Messaging Devices, one of the company’s fastest growing categories of devices.

 

AT&T customers with these devices historically haven’t had the same convenient access as AT&T smartphone customers to thousands of compelling, new applications. Since AT&T launched its pioneering line-up of Quick Messaging Devices in fall 2008, about 30 percent of the company’s postpaid customers who are new or upgrading have purchased this type of device. AT&T is committed to spurring innovation and apps development for the millions of customers in this category.

 

Quick Messaging Devices are integrated devices that are value priced and texting centric; they have full QWERTY keyboards, either physical or virtual, and, since this past fall, full Web browsing capabilities. Customers with these devices are more likely to demand apps, subscribe to messaging and data plans, and are a large potential market for application developers, according to AT&T research.

 

AT&T Chief Marketing Officer David Christopher announced plans to begin rolling out Quick Messaging Devices with BREW Mobile Platform in the second half of the year, so that by year end 2011, about 90 percent of AT&T’s devices in this segment are planned to be based on BREW Mobile Platform. AT&T announced that Samsung will be its first device maker to launch a Quick Messaging Device featuring BREW Mobile Platform. HTC, LG and Pantech also are building devices featuring BREW Mobile Platform for planned availability in late 2010 or early 2011.

 

“Today, developers must essentially rebuild apps for different handsets and operating systems, increasing their costs, slowing the pace of innovation and stalling the delivery of mobile apps to customers,” Christopher said. “We want to tear down the barriers and make it much easier for developers to reach our customers – and for our customers to access apps. Moving to one platform for this fast growing segment of devices will help developers reach millions more customers who want easy access to the hottest mobile apps.”

 

To help developers jumpstart apps development for AT&T’s BREW Mobile Platform devices, Christopher announced a new AT&T SDK which features support for BREW Mobile Platform, continued support for Java and widgets, and includes tools to help developers tap into AT&T network capabilities as they design and code their applications. The new AT&T SDK is available starting today at sdk.developer.att.com.

 

Taking the AT&T Developer Program to the Next Level

AT&T has a longstanding commitment to the developer community. It was among the first major carriers to offer a developer program and has been rated the top carrier development program for the past three years by Evans Data. Today, AT&T executives also announced plans, including some launch schedules, for a series of new or enhanced developer resources including:

 

Technical support for developers via live chat -- something no other carrier, operating system provider or handset maker offers today – and a tripling of overall tech support by mid-2010.

 

* Revenue share featuring a standardized 70/30 split for third-party developers in the AT&T App Center.

* AT&T Sandbox, a virtual network environment for developers to test and evaluate applications, which is planned to be available in 2Q 2010.

* AT&T Developer Dashboard, a tool that will let developers track the status of their app once submitted to AT&T, support digital signing of business agreements with AT&T, allow developers to set prices for their apps, and provide performance metrics and customer satisfaction feedback. The dashboard is available now for enterprise application developers and the certification of emerging devices. And for AT&T’s consumer development community, the dashboard will also provide needed automation which is planned for the first quarter of 2010.

* New marketing and referral relationships announced today between AT&T and other global carriers using GSM, the de facto world standard for wireless technology. The companies intend to create streamlined processes that help developers make their applications available to their combined base of hundreds of millions of customers.

* AT&T Developer Council, an advisory group hosted by AT&T and made up of leading development and technology companies and other influencers, such as EA Games, Telenav and Bonfire Media.

 

AT&T also announced a trial program with WaveMarket to make network location information accessible through Veriplace, WaveMarket’s cloud location aggregation platform currently in use by more than 1,000 developers. Veriplace allows SMS, Web, WAP and IVR developers to develop location-aware apps and services across device categories and participating carriers. The trial program will launch in the coming weeks.

 

AT&T Chief Technology Officer John Donovan also said that a new AT&T Virtual Innovation Lab will open in Atlanta in the second quarter to provide developer support for speech, location and messaging APIs (application programming interfaces). In addition, two new Innovation Centers, one in the East and one in the West, are planned for late 2010 to provide 3G and 4G RF (radio frequency) development support, testing and demos.
